Cherasco is a historic town located in the province of Cuneo, in the Piedmont region of northern Italy. Founded in 1243, the town is known for its distinctive orthogonal urban layout with two main intersecting streets forming the heart of the historic center. Cherasco has maintained much of its medieval and baroque architecture, with numerous palaces and churches dotting its streets. The town is particularly noted for its cultural heritage, including significant baroque buildings and ancient city walls.
It has played an important role in Italian history, being the site of multiple peace treaties, including the Armistice of Cherasco signed by Napoleon Bonaparte in 1796. Today, Cherasco is also known for its local culinary traditions, particularly its chocolate-making heritage and the production of Bagna càuda, a typical Piedmontese dish.
